There are a variety of storage containers, and all conform to ISO standards and can be transported safely aboard cranes, ships or trucks. Dry or general-purpose containers are the most popular shipping containers. They are available in 40-foot and 20-foot sizes with an internal height of eight feet. height. High cube containers are nine feet six inch taller and can offer an impressive increase in volume for taller items.
Reefers are a kind of ISO container that is designed to carry products at a temperature that is controlled. These can be used to transport a variety of items, including fresh produce and pharmaceuticals. Typically, they are utilized for long-haul transportation and are often customized to meet specific requirements.
Open top containers are a different kind of shipping container. They have a movable roof, making it easy to load and unload freight. These are often used to transport oversized items that aren't able to fit through the normal containers' doors. They typically come in 20-foot and 40 foot sizes. Containers with flat racks with side panels that can be collapsed and can be towed on bed trucks are another alternative.
Tank shipping containers are large metal containers that can be used to transport gas and liquids. They are constructed of sturdy steel and lined with an impermeable substance that helps protect the cargo from leakage and corrosion. Tank shipping containers can be used to transport hazardous substances, like crude oil, and chemicals.

The general square footage of shipping containers is between 160 and 320 square feet, depending on whether you pick the high cube or standard model. The difference between the two types is that the high cube containers come with 9.5-foot ceilings, while the regular containers come with 8.2-foot ceilings. High-cube containers tend to be preferred since they allow you to install insulation and run utilities without worries about running out of space.
